What is a Blockchain Energy Grid?

A blockchain energy grid refers to an energy distribution system that utilizes blockchain technology to manage and optimize energy flow. This system allows for peer-to-peer energy trading, where consumers can buy and sell energy directly without intermediaries. This decentralized approach promotes energy independence and efficiency.

How Blockchain Can Optimize Energy Distribution

Blockchain technology can significantly enhance energy distribution in several ways

Decentralization: By removing intermediaries, blockchain allows for direct transactions between energy producers and consumers.

Transparency: All transactions are recorded on a public ledger, ensuring accountability and reducing fraud.

Smart Contracts: Automated contracts can facilitate transactions, ensuring that agreements are executed without delays.

Blockchain Energy Trading Platforms

Energy trading platforms powered by blockchain technology are emerging as a game-changer. These platforms enable users to trade energy directly, fostering a competitive market. For instance, platforms like Power Ledger allow consumers to sell excess energy generated from solar panels to their neighbors.

Case Studies of Blockchain Energy Grids

Several case studies illustrate the successful implementation of blockchain in energy distribution

Brooklyn Microgrid: This project allows residents to sell excess solar energy to their neighbors using blockchain technology.
Power Ledger: This platform enables peer-to-peer energy trading, allowing users to buy and sell renewable energy directly.

Challenges in Implementing Blockchain Energy Grids

Despite its potential, implementing blockchain in energy grids comes with challenges

Regulatory Compliance: Navigating the regulatory landscape can be complex, as energy markets are often heavily regulated.
Technical Barriers: Integrating blockchain with existing energy infrastructure can pose technical challenges.
Public Awareness: Educating consumers about blockchain technology and its benefits is crucial for widespread adoption.
